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
338086 1444467338 71087983845 7659 5491045766
6262854 5142849327 5329395
6262854 5142849327 5329395
461 10970680 5444693848 674985527
All about undefined
Interested in learning more?
6262854 5142849327 5329395
461 10970680 5444693848 674985527
See more
1366708 88928846046 73
49044 82603 70061972 718136
See more
06902856730 7528814365
137145 49394049 59 34
See more